Masjid Nasional Al Akbar Surabaya Pamerkan Al Quran Kuno Tulisan Tangan Warisan Ulama Nusantara

SEAToday.com, Surabaya - Pameran warisan intelektual ulama nusantara digelar di Masjid Nasional Al-Akbar, Surabaya, Jawa Timur. Pameran yang digelar hingga Senin (24/3) ini menghadirkan berbagai koleksi naskah kuno dan infografis tentang perjuangan, pemikiran dan kontribusi ulama Nusantara terhadap perkembangan Islam di Indonesia hingga internasional.
Pameran tersebut diselenggarakan atas kerjasama Dinas Perpustakaan dan Kearsipan Jawa Timur bersama Nahdlatul Ulama.
Di sini, pengunjung dapat melihat Al-quran kuno yang ditulis tangan warisan ulama nusantara. Selain itu,, ada pula pameran tentang Manuskrip Tegalsari yang ditemukan di Gerbang Tinatar.
